
Just In: Ohio State DC Jim Knowles Responds to Oklahoma Job Rumors: “Just Trying to Beat Notre Dame”
Ohio State defensive coordinator Jim Knowles addressed recent speculation linking him to the vacant defensive coordinator position at the University of Oklahoma. Amid swirling rumors, Knowles stayed laser-focused on the Buckeyes’ upcoming clash with Notre Dame, dismissing the chatter with a clear and direct response: “I’m just trying to beat Notre Dame.”
The rumors surfaced after Oklahoma’s defensive coordinator position became available, sparking speculation about potential candidates, including Knowles. Known for his defensive prowess and strategic brilliance, the Ohio State coordinator was quickly named in reports as a possible fit for the Sooners’ program.
However, during a press conference ahead of Ohio State’s highly anticipated matchup against Notre Dame, Knowles downplayed the speculation. He emphasized his commitment to the Buckeyes and the importance of preparing for one of the biggest games of the season.
